Boutique full-stack digital agency based in Melbourne, serving over 300 businesses and non-profits since 2013. Certified Google and Facebook Partner offering strategy, branding, web development, SEO, PPC, and social media marketing.

GO MO Group is a generative AI-driven B2B digital marketing agency specializing in SEO, SEM, and pull marketing. They help B2B companies meet new buying behaviors through data-driven strategies and have offices in Sweden, England, and India.
